IPIPGO ip proxy BeautifulSoup Web Crawl: Practical Examples

BeautifulSoup Web Crawl: Practical Examples

The website capture always be blocked IP, hand to teach you to use proxy ip around the pit Recently, some do data collection buddies and I spit, said with BeautifulSoup to catch a data immovable to eat closed door. Last week, there is an e-commerce price comparison brother, just run two days script IP was blacked out, so angry he jumped straight to his feet. Today we ...

BeautifulSoup Web Crawl: Practical Examples

The website crawling always be blocked IP, hand to teach you to use proxy ip around pit

Recently, a number of data collection buddies and I complained, said BeautifulSoup to grab a data motionless to eat the door. Last week there is an e-commerce price comparison brother, just run two days script IP was blacked out, so angry he jumped straight to his feet. Today we will nag about this matter, teach you to use the proxy ipipgo's skill to break the game.

Why does your crawler keep getting caught?

Many newbies think that parsing a web page with BeautifulSoup is all they need, but then they get caught by the security guards just as they reach for it. Here's the trickFrequency of visits too regular, just like when you wear the same clothes and go to your neighbor's house every day to borrow salt, a fool can see that something is wrong.

That's when it's time to learn what a chameleon can do.Every time I visit, I change my vest.It's a good idea to use ipipgo's proxy IP pool. It's like using ipipgo's proxy IP pool to randomly change the exit IP for each request, and the site simply can't figure out where you're coming from.

Actual equipment list

artifact corresponds English -ity, -ism, -ization note
Python 3.8+ programming environment Don't use the old school version.
Requests Library Sending network requests Remember to install 2.0+
BeautifulSoup4 Parsing web content Not to be confused with bs3.
ipipgo proxy packages IP masquerading tool Newbies get the best value with volume-based packages

Agent Integration in Four Steps

1. Go to the ipipgo website firstGet a trial pack.I'm sorry, but 5 bucks of traffic is enough to practice.
2. Add proxy settings to the code:

proxies = {
    'http': 'http://用户名:密码@gateway.ipipgo.com:9020',
    'https': 'https://用户名:密码@gateway.ipipgo.com:9020'
}
response = requests.get(url, proxies=proxies)

3. Add to requestsRandom Waiting TimeDon't be a machine gun.
4. Regularly check if the IP is exposed with ipipgo'sIP Survival Detection Interfacehave a quick look

Common Rollover Scene Rescue

Q: Obviously hang the proxy or get banned?
A: Check if the proxy is working, use httpbin.org/ip to verify if the IP has changed. If you are using a shared package, you may have to change your IP to a dedicated one.

Q: What should I do if the agent response is slow to a snail's pace?
A: Switch the line type in the ipipgo backend, mobile IPs are usually faster than home broadband. Don't use free proxies, that shit is slower than a bicycle

Q: What should I do if I encounter an SSL certificate error?
A: Eighty percent of the proxy certificate is not installed, go to the ipipgo document center to download the latest CA certificate, requests plus verify parameter specified path

Why do you recommend ipipgo?

The IP pool for this one is really wild enough that the last time it was testedI've cut over 200 exits in half an hour, and they're all the same.. In particular, theirmixing and matching technologyThe most important thing is that you can mix the IPs of the three major carriers randomly, and the wind control system of the website is directly confused. Recently, the new dynamic residential agent, catching the mobile web page that is called a smooth.

Newbies are advised to start with the entire5 Dollar Experience PackIf you don't have enough money, you can upgrade at any time. If you do long-term projects, directly on the annual payment package can save a cell phone money, customer service can also give customized collection program.

Say something from the heart.

Engage in data collection is like playing guerrilla warfare, don't hard just website defense. Once I used ipipgo's polling mode, with the random generation of request headers, and continuously picked up an e-commerce platform for half a month without turning over. Remember.Proxy IP quality makes the difference between success and failureDon't use those garbage proxies to save a small amount of money, you won't be able to cry when you get blocked.

我们的产品仅支持在境外网络环境下使用(除TikTok专线外),用户使用IPIPGO从事的任何行为均不代表IPIPGO的意志和观点,IPIPGO不承担任何法律责任。

business scenario

Discover more professional services solutions

💡 Click on the button for more details on specialized services

美国长效动态住宅ip资源上新!

Professional foreign proxy ip service provider-IPIPGO

Contact Us

Contact Us

13260757327

Online Inquiry. QQ chat

E-mail: hai.liu@xiaoxitech.com

Working hours: Monday to Friday, 9:30-18:30, holidays off
Follow WeChat
Follow us on WeChat

Follow us on WeChat

Back to top
en_USEnglish